20.The Prodigy – The Fat Of The Land.

This amazing album from British group features some of their classic songs like “Firestarter” and “Breathe”. The album is included in the book “1001 Albums You Must Hear Before You Die.” And contains that characteristic awkward look from the band with their high tempo dance beat.

19.Shania Twain – Come On Over.

This album showed us that Canadians could do some serious and incredible country. As it included some of the most sounded songs of the decade. Including “You’re Still the One”, “That Don’t Impress Me Much,” and “Man! I Feel Like A Woman.”

18.Busta Rhymes – When Disaster Strikes …

The incredible rap artist that can throw rhymes faster than more could ever dream of. It continues the theme of apocalypse, as his previous album and was a commercial success open in third in the Billboard 200. It included “Put Your Hands Where My Eyes Could See” and “Dangerous”

16.Wu-Tang Clan – Wu-Tang Forever.

One of the best rap groups ever, and without a doubt of the 90’s.  This second album of the group, after a long run of successful solo projects from various of its members, debuted number 1 on the Billboard charts. And counted with the featuring of various of the group’s associates.

15.Smash Mouth – Fush Yu Mang.

What could be more 90’s than Smash Mouth? The album’s name was taken from a slurred “f*ck you, man” by Al Pacino in Scarface. As well it contains some of the band’s best-known songs like “Walking On The Sun” and their cover of War’s “Why Can’t We Be Friends?”

14.Radiohead – Ok Computer.

Again one of the most influential alternative bands of the decade. It was the first self-produced album of the band. And it includes some classical songs like “Paranoid Android,” “No Surprises,” and “Karma Police.”

13.The Verve – Urban Hymns.

The band’s third and best-selling album. And not only for them, as for 2015 the album was ranked the 18th best-selling album in Uk chart’s history.  Urban Hymns contains the band’s most known song “Bittersweet Symphony,” that immediately remounts you to epic images. 12.Daft Punk – Homework.

The debut album of the incredible French dance powerhouse. As it revived house music, something that nowadays Dj’s would thank a lot. The album contains some of the most well known and enjoyable songs from the duo like “Around The World” and “Da Funk.”

11.Björk – Homogenic.

The always odd but incredible Icelandic Björk’s third album. The album was produced in collaboration with Mark Bell, whom she cites as a major influence in her music. As well the music style of the album focuses on electronic beats and string instruments with songs in tribute to her native country. Containing some songs like “Joga,” “Bachelorette,” and “All Is Full of Love”

 9.Blur – Blur.

One of the best, if not the best for many, bands of the 90’s. Blur was part of that indie British invasion along with Oasis. But they had that happier sillier tone. The album changed a bit the style of the band since the guitarist was strongly influenced by the band Pavement. It contains some of their most successful songs like “Bettlebump” and the legendary “Song 2.”

8.Green Day – Nimrod.

One of the best albums of the legendary pop-punk band. The album includes a lot of different influences. As it contains musical elements of folk, surf rock, and ska. Along with Armstrong’s incredible lyrics. The album features some of the band’s classics like “Hitching A Ride” and “Good Riddance (Time of Your Life)” who became part of the pop culture of the decade.

6.Mariah Carey – Butterfly.

The fifth album of the incredible singer included tons of new things. Like the experimentation of hip-hop sounds and the featuring of various artists and producers of this gender. The album includes one of Carey’s most popular songs “Honey” and “My All.”

4.Creed – My Own Prison.

The debut album from one of the most iconical bands of the 90’s. It is one of the top 200 selling albums of all time in the United States and it spent 150 weeks on the Billboard 200 chart. The album contains songs like “My Own Prison” and “Waht’s Life For?.”Image Credit: wikipedia.com

3.Blink 182 – Dude Ranch.

The second album of the other kings of pop-punk and the legends of toilette humor. The album cemented Blink’s stardom. And it was the last album that features the original drummer Scott Raynor. It contains some of the band’s most iconic songs like “Josie” and “Dammit.” Full of their silly and dirty humor, shown in the songs and their videos.

2.Foo Fighters – The Colour and the Shape.

Is the debut album of Foo Fighters as a group. As the name was originally a Dave Grohl’s solo project for a demo. The album gave a kind of rebirth to grunge. And it features some of the band’s and the 90’s most iconic songs. Like “Monkey Wrench”, “My Hero,” and “Everlong.”

1.The Notorious B.I.G. – Life After Death.

Is the second album from the legendary rapper. And it was released posthumously following his death on March 9. It features collaborations with tons of famous guest artists such. And it is a cult album of the mafioso rap subgenre. It features one of the most legendary songs of the 90’s “Mo Money Mo Problems.”
